OpenGL在FBG传感网络结构健康监测中的应用

摘    要:对飞机机翼三维重建方法及其应用进行了研究,并采用开放性图形库OpenGL(Open Graphics Librar-y)三维图形软件接口标准,在Visual C 6.0平台下开发了基于光纤布拉格光栅FBG(Fiber Bragg Grating)动态应变采集与机翼模型三维重建系统.本文通过共享数据库的方式,在机翼模型与FBG传感网络数据直接建立连接,FBG传感器数据变化可实时在三维机翼模型中进行体现,由此实现了直观地对飞机机翼各监测点应变情况的实时监测.
